   Financial close software provides tools to help businesses complete the financial close cycle, enabling accountants to ensure books are accurate, track task completion via checklists, manage reconciliations, and monitor individual progress and deadlines across each close period.

### Core Capabilities of Financial Close Software

To qualify for inclusion in the Financial Close category, a product must:

- Allow users to create checklists and individual tasks related to closing accounting books
- Track the financial close process so users can view progress, timelines, and approvals
- Provide tools such as reconciliation repositories or reconciliation management to help users compare financial data
- Integrate with or import spreadsheets from other database or accounting software products

### Common Use Cases for Financial Close Software

Accounting teams use financial close software to streamline the end-of-period close process and reduce errors. Common use cases include:

- Managing month-end and year-end close checklists with task assignment and deadline tracking
- Reconciling accounts and comparing financial data sets to identify inconsistencies
- Maintaining a historical database of past close periods organized by month and transaction type

### How Financial Close Software Differs from Other Tools

Financial close software is purpose-built for the accounting close cycle, distinguishing it from broader financial platforms. These tools typically integrate with spreadsheets and accounting software to document relevant data, and may also integrate with or come packaged with [corporate performance management (CPM)](https://www.g2.com/categories/corporate-performance-management-cpm) features such as financial consolidation or [budgeting and forecasting](https://www.g2.com/categories/budgeting-and-forecasting) tools.

### Financial Close Software FAQs

#### **What is financial consolidation and close?**

Financial consolidation and close is the process finance teams use to collect, reconcile, and finalize financial data across entities before reporting results. It typically includes account reconciliations, journal entries, intercompany matching, task management, and final reporting, all designed to help organizations close the books accurately and on time.

#### **What is the difference between commercial close and financial close?**

Commercial close usually refers to finalizing the business terms of a deal or transaction, while financial close refers to completing the accounting process required to report financial results for a period. In practice, financial close is an internal finance and accounting workflow, whereas commercial close is more often tied to contracts, sales, or transaction execution.

#### **How long does financial close take?**

Financial close timelines vary based on company size, system complexity, and how much of the process is automated, but many organizations still spend several days to multiple weeks completing month-end or quarter-end close. Teams using financial close automation software often reduce delays by standardizing workflows, automating reconciliations, and improving visibility into close status.
